What happened on this day in history August 17?

On August 17, 1987, Rudolf Hess, the last member of Adolf Hitler’s inner circle, died at Spandau Prison at age 93, an apparent suicide. On this date: In 1969, Hurricane Camille slammed into the Mississippi coast as a Category 5 storm that was blamed for 256 U.S. deaths, three in Cuba.

What is special about the 17th of August?

This Day in History: August 17 On this day in 1945, Sukarno declared Indonesia’s independence from the Netherlands, and, after the Dutch transferred sovereignty four years later, he served as the country’s first president (1949–67).

What happened August 19th?

Also on this day: 1812: The USS Constitution defeats the British frigate HMS Guerriere off Nova Scotia during the War of 1812, earning the nickname “Old Ironsides.” 1848: The New York Herald reports the discovery of gold in California.

Which day is celebrated on 19 August?

World Photography Day is observed on 19 August annually to raise awareness about the importance of photography. World Humanitarian Day is observed annually on 19 August around the world to pay tribute to aid workers who risk their lives in humanitarian service.
